jQuery中使用Ajax获取JSON格式数据示例代码

2024-04-22 23:04:41 浏览

jQuery中的使用Ajax获取JSON格式数据示例代码是:

jQuery是一个快速、简洁的JavaScript框架,是继Prototype之后又一个优秀的JavaScript代码库(框架)于2006年1月由John Resig发布。jQuery设计的宗旨是“write Less,Do More”,即倡导写更少的代码,做更多的事情。它封装JavaScript常用的功能代码,提供一种简便的JavaScript设计模式,优化HTML文档操作、事件处理、动画设计和Ajax交互。

jQuery中Ajax获取JSON格式数

以下是一个简单的jQuery AJAX从URL获取JSON数据对象的示例代码:

      // 成功获得数据后的处理代码

      console.log(data); // 打印数据对象到控制台

      // 获取数据失败的处理代码

1. 使用jQuery的`$.ajax()`函数发出GET请求,向指定的URL地址请求数据。

2. `type`参数指定请求方法,`url`参数指定请求的URL地址,`dataType`参数指定请求的数据类型为JSON。

3. `success`回调函数在成功获取数据后执行,`data`参数表示JSON数据对象。

4. `error`回调函数在获取数据失败时执行,`xhr`参数为XMLHttpRequest对象,`status`参数表示失败的状态字符,`error`参数表示失败的错误对象。

需要注意的是,发送跨域请求时,需要设置`crossDomain: true`和`jsonp: false`参数。 

$.ajax({ url:'/cgi/getArtical', //请求的某个action的地址 datatype:"json"

, //只有指定为json下面才可以直接用返回的json数据,否则要转化 type:'post', success:function (data) { PutArtical(data)

; //该函数中处理json格式的文章数据data; HideTip()

; //处理完文章后关闭加载提示 }, beforeSend:function(){ LoadTip("正在加载文章")

;//这里是加载过程中的等待提示,可以自己定义 }})

本文版权声明本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请联系本站客服,一经查实,本站将立刻删除。